1.oracle同步mysql代码

This commit is contained in:
wr
2024-06-01 18:41:01 +08:00
parent ef902c11c3
commit 3880d431cd
18 changed files with 691 additions and 64 deletions

View File

@@ -39,171 +39,171 @@ public class RStatDataID implements Serializable {
private Integer qualityFlag;
@TableField(value = "i_neg")
private Double iNeg;
private Float iNeg;
@TableField(value = "i_pos")
private Double iPos;
private Float iPos;
@TableField(value = "i_thd")
private Double iThd;
private Float iThd;
@TableField(value = "i_unbalance")
private Double iUnbalance;
private Float iUnbalance;
@TableField(value = "i_zero")
private Double iZero;
private Float iZero;
@TableField(value = "rms")
private Double rms;
private Float rms;
@TableField(value = "i_1")
private Double i1;
private Float i1;
@TableField(value = "i_2")
private Double i2;
private Float i2;
@TableField(value = "i_3")
private Double i3;
private Float i3;
@TableField(value = "i_4")
private Double i4;
private Float i4;
@TableField(value = "i_5")
private Double i5;
private Float i5;
@TableField(value = "i_6")
private Double i6;
private Float i6;
@TableField(value = "i_7")
private Double i7;
private Float i7;
@TableField(value = "i_8")
private Double i8;
private Float i8;
@TableField(value = "i_9")
private Double i9;
private Float i9;
@TableField(value = "i_10")
private Double i10;
private Float i10;
@TableField(value = "i_11")
private Double i11;
private Float i11;
@TableField(value = "i_12")
private Double i12;
private Float i12;
@TableField(value = "i_13")
private Double i13;
private Float i13;
@TableField(value = "i_14")
private Double i14;
private Float i14;
@TableField(value = "i_15")
private Double i15;
private Float i15;
@TableField(value = "i_16")
private Double i16;
private Float i16;
@TableField(value = "i_17")
private Double i17;
private Float i17;
@TableField(value = "i_18")
private Double i18;
private Float i18;
@TableField(value = "i_19")
private Double i19;
private Float i19;
@TableField(value = "i_20")
private Double i20;
private Float i20;
@TableField(value = "i_21")
private Double i21;
private Float i21;
@TableField(value = "i_22")
private Double i22;
private Float i22;
@TableField(value = "i_23")
private Double i23;
private Float i23;
@TableField(value = "i_24")
private Double i24;
private Float i24;
@TableField(value = "i_25")
private Double i25;
private Float i25;
@TableField(value = "i_26")
private Double i26;
private Float i26;
@TableField(value = "i_27")
private Double i27;
private Float i27;
@TableField(value = "i_28")
private Double i28;
private Float i28;
@TableField(value = "i_29")
private Double i29;
private Float i29;
@TableField(value = "i_30")
private Double i30;
private Float i30;
@TableField(value = "i_31")
private Double i31;
private Float i31;
@TableField(value = "i_32")
private Double i32;
private Float i32;
@TableField(value = "i_33")
private Double i33;
private Float i33;
@TableField(value = "i_34")
private Double i34;
private Float i34;
@TableField(value = "i_35")
private Double i35;
private Float i35;
@TableField(value = "i_36")
private Double i36;
private Float i36;
@TableField(value = "i_37")
private Double i37;
private Float i37;
@TableField(value = "i_38")
private Double i38;
private Float i38;
@TableField(value = "i_39")
private Double i39;
private Float i39;
@TableField(value = "i_40")
private Double i40;
private Float i40;
@TableField(value = "i_41")
private Double i41;
private Float i41;
@TableField(value = "i_42")
private Double i42;
private Float i42;
@TableField(value = "i_43")
private Double i43;
private Float i43;
@TableField(value = "i_44")
private Double i44;
private Float i44;
@TableField(value = "i_45")
private Double i45;
private Float i45;
@TableField(value = "i_46")
private Double i46;
private Float i46;
@TableField(value = "i_47")
private Double i47;
private Float i47;
@TableField(value = "i_48")
private Double i48;
private Float i48;
@TableField(value = "i_49")
private Double i49;
private Float i49;
@TableField(value = "i_50")
private Double i50;
private Float i50;
}

View File

@@ -33,6 +33,12 @@ public interface OracleDataService {
* @return
*/
List<LimitRate> getLimitRate(String time);
/**
* 查询oracle中PQS_ComAsses数据
* @param time
* @return
*/
List<PqsComAsses> getPqsComAsses(String time);
/**
* 查询oracle中LIMIT_Target数据
@@ -40,4 +46,17 @@ public interface OracleDataService {
* @return
*/
List<LimitTarget> getLimitTarget(String time);
/**
* 查询oracle中PQS_ComAsses数据
* @param time
* @return
*/
List<PqsAsses> getPqsAsses(String time);
/**
* 查询oracle中DAY_I数据
* @param time
* @return
*/
List<DayI> getDayI(String time);
}

View File

@@ -18,10 +18,11 @@ import java.util.List;
public class OracleDataServiceImpl implements OracleDataService {
private final DayHarmrateVMapper dayHarmrateVMapper;
private final PqsIntegrityMapper pqsIntegrityMapper;
private final DayVMapper dayVMapper;
private final PqsComAssesMapper pqsComAssesMapper;
private final PqsAssesMapper pqsAssesMapper;
private final DayIMapper dayIMapper;
private final LimitRateMapper limitRateMapper;
@@ -61,4 +62,25 @@ public class OracleDataServiceImpl implements OracleDataService {
lambdaQueryWrapper.apply("TIMEID = to_date({0},'yyyy-mm-dd')",time);
return limitTargetMapper.selectList(lambdaQueryWrapper);
}
@Override
public List<PqsComAsses> getPqsComAsses(String time) {
LambdaQueryWrapper<PqsComAsses> lambdaQueryWrapper = new LambdaQueryWrapper<>();
lambdaQueryWrapper.apply("TIMEID = to_date({0},'yyyy-mm-dd')",time);
return pqsComAssesMapper.selectList(lambdaQueryWrapper);
}
@Override
public List<PqsAsses> getPqsAsses(String time) {
LambdaQueryWrapper<PqsAsses> lambdaQueryWrapper = new LambdaQueryWrapper<>();
lambdaQueryWrapper.apply("TIMEID = to_date({0},'yyyy-mm-dd')",time);
return pqsAssesMapper.selectList(lambdaQueryWrapper);
}
@Override
public List<DayI> getDayI(String time) {
LambdaQueryWrapper<DayI> lambdaQueryWrapper = new LambdaQueryWrapper<>();
lambdaQueryWrapper.apply("TIMEID = to_date({0},'yyyy-mm-dd')",time);
return dayIMapper.selectList(lambdaQueryWrapper);
}
}